以枇杷(Eriobotrya japonica Lindl.)花黄酮提取液(EjFF)为受试物,采用复方地芬诺酯建立小鼠便秘模型,通过小鼠小肠推进实验和排便实验,评估其对小鼠的首粒排便时间、5 h内排便粒数和排便量、小肠墨汁推进率以及小鼠结肠突触素(SY)含量的影响.结果显示:EjFF不影响小鼠体质量,但能显著缩短小鼠排便时间,增加5 h内排便粒数和排便量,提高小肠墨汁推进率,并提高小鼠结肠SY含量(p<0.05).上述结果表明EjFF可以有效缓解小肠运动障碍.

Eriobotrya japonica flower flavonides extract(EjFF)was studied regarding its ability to mitigate intestinal motility disorders.A mouse model of diphenoxylate-induced constipation was established in the bowel evacuation and intestinal motility experiments.The first evacuation time,the number of fecal pellets and the weight of faces in 5 h,the movement rate of ink in the small intestine,and the effect on colonic synaptophysin(SY)contents were measured.The results showed that EjFF intragastical administration had no effect on body weights of mice,while compared with the model group,the groups treated with EjFF exhibited a shortened evacuation time,an increased number of fecal pellets,an increased weight of feces in 5 h,an increased movement rate of ink,and increased SY contents(p<0.05).Therefore,the results demonstrate that EjFF can mitigate intestinal motility disorders in mice.
